Living in Lyndeborough, NH
Nestled in the scenic hills of New Hampshire, Lyndeborough offers a quaint rural lifestyle with a strong sense of community. Known for its abundant outdoor activities, residents enjoy proximity to nature, with hiking, fishing, and camping opportunities nearby. Historical charm shines through in its local architecture and small-town events, creating a peaceful yet vibrant environment for both families and retirees.

Home Value Estimator For Lyndeborough, NH
There are currently 696 real estate properties
in Lyndeborough, NH,
with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price
of $502,094.00. What is an AVM? It is
a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home,
property or land in Lyndeborough, NH, based on current market
trends, comparable real
est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other
vari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ers
and
s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process. For
